Anyone see In Bruges? What do you think of it?

I saw it last night and it’s not what I expected. It’s about hired killers who are told to hide out in a nowhere town in Belgium after a hit goes bad. It didn’t grab me at first because I was annoyed by the presence Colin Farrell. But I got more into it as it went on, and by the time I got to the end, I thought, “Wow, that was good.”
